Output ed2fe17bad196176f650e435a18aae7c597dfaec3ae1ae2514a6b208808ae4bf:29

value
976787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e49a51aa35bd6c53e6e74568eb01f228fa943b0e OP_EQUAL
address
3NXkrZ3y8zgqVjJjAFqnb9pphM7FXe8MWK
transaction
ed2fe17bad196176f650e435a18aae7c597dfaec3ae1ae2514a6b208808ae4bf
spent
true